How did you get into your field?

After college I moved to Florida with the plan to play on a couple of mini tours. I found Frenchman’s Creek Beach and Country Club, and as long as I worked full time for them they gave me a place to practice year-round. After working there for a few months they eventually asked me if I wanted to become an Assistant Golf Professional and enroll in the PGA program. Now here I am.

How long have you been with Cordillera Ranch?

I started working at Cordillera on May 1, 2015.

Cordillera Ranch POA

Amenity Reservations on the Ranch

Cordillera Ranch offers a variety of amenities for property owners and the new POA website allows online reservations for those amenities. To place a reservation request, simply log into the Cordillera Ranch POA website at www.cordilleraranchpoa.com, use the drop down on the For Residents tab and select Reservations, which lists the multiple amenities available. Property owners will then need to select which amenity they wish to reserve, and fill out the online form. The completed form is sent to the POA to review, at which time the POA will approve or deny the request. Once a decision has been made by the POA, the property owner is notified.
